Broadway and Classical Music Veterans Unite for FROM BACH TO BROADWAY at Symphony Space
by Julie Musbach - Jan 22, 2017


MONDAY, JANUARY 23 at 7:00PM, the Tenants' Action Group (TAG) of 711 West End Avenue presents a special evening showcasing Upper West Side musical talent. All of the participating artists are present and former Upper West Side or 711 West End Avenue residents, who have collaborated to produce a program of repertoire with special meaning for their lives. The first half of the concert will feature classical selections performed by pianists Warren Jones, Margaret Kampmeier and Erika Nickrenz, cellist Sara Sant'Ambrogio, guitarist Andrew Schulman and former 711 West End Resident, flutist Eugenia Zukerman. The second half of the program is devoted to Broadway and cabaret with vocal selections from Britt Swanson Cryer, David Cryer, Gretchen Cryer, Nikki Renee Daniels, Anita Gillette, Jeff Kready, Quinn Lemley, Heather Mac Rae and Howard McGillin supported by pianist Nancy Ford and bassist Sean Smith. They will announce the program from the stage - along with the corresponding stories. Benefit tickets are priced at $75 (premium seating) and $50, and include a meet-the-artists' reception following the performance.

BURLESQUE TO BROADWAY with Quinn Lemley Set for The Cutting Room, Begin. 11/3
by Tyler Peterson - Oct 28, 2014


The high-octane theatrical concert, "Burlesque to Broadway" starring Quinn Lemley will dazzle audiences at New York City's premiere venue The Cutting Room (44 E 32nd Street between Park and Madison) every Monday night in November. This lightning-in-a-bottle survey of American burlesque -- with Lemley leading a tight-knit coterie of showgirls through heart-racing choreography, in eye-popping costumes -- is supported by a razor-sharp nine-piece live band under the music direction of Daniel Lincoln. Performances are November (3rd, 10th, 17th and 24th) at 8pm with doors at 6:30pm.
